Output stage and interface

The DRV2603RUNT: The half-bridge output configuration (two outputs) drives the actuator differentially — the ERM or LRA sees the full supply swing across its terminals, not a single-ended pulse. This doubles the available voltage swing compared to a single-ended drive at the same supply rail. Control is via a parallel interface or a PWM input, giving the host MCU flexibility: a dedicated PWM timer pin can drive the haptic waveform directly, or the parallel port can set the drive level with a few GPIO lines.
